IMSI Design, CAD software solution developer, debuts DesignCAD 2025.1, a maintenance release that delivers various refinements across the application, addressing user-reported issues and enhancing everyday drafting and modeling workflows, the company reports.

Service Pack Highlights

The DesignCAD 2025.1 maintenance release delivers refinements, such as improved overall usability, enhanced interface consistency, and resolution of issues related to file handling, import/export reliability, customization options, licensing behavior, and system stability. It also includes corrections in drawing and parametric functions, updated localization components, and behind-the-scenes improvements.

Availability & Pricing

DesignCAD 2025.1 is available at no additional cost to existing DesignCAD 2025 users. Upgrade pricing for users of earlier versions is available at www.imsidesign.com and www.turbocadpro.com.
